Russia - Poultry Meat Slaughtering

Since 2014, Russia Poultry Meat Slaughtering increased 2.3% year on year. With 2,557,284 Thousand Heads in 2019, the country was ranked number 6 comparing other countries in Poultry Meat Slaughtering. Russia is overtaken by India, which was number 5 with 2,764,540 Thousand Heads and is followed by Iran with 1,970,411 Thousand Heads. China lead the ranking with 14,204,062 Thousand Heads in 2019, an increase of 2.2% compared to 2018. United States, Brazil and Indonesia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Tajikistan witnessed the best average annual growth at +27.7% per year, while Saint Kitts and Nevis witnessed the worst performance at -100% per year.
